which graph matches this direct variation equation? \\y = -2x\\

Identify key features of the equation

\[

$$\begin{aligned} &y = -2x \\ &\text{Slope } (m) = -2 \\ &\text{y-intercept } (b) = 0 \end{aligned}$$

\]

Determine points on the graph

\[

$$\begin{aligned} &x = 0 \implies y = 0 \quad (0,0) \\ &x = 1 \implies y = -2 \quad (1,-2) \\ &x = -1 \implies y = 2 \quad (-1,2) \end{aligned}$$

\]

Match points with the given options

\[

$$\begin{aligned} &\text{Graph 1 (Left): passes through } (0,0), (-1,2), (1,-2) \\ &\text{Graph 2 (Middle): passes through } (0,0), (1,2), (-1,-2) \\ &\text{Graph 3 (Right): passes through } (0,0), (-1,3), (1,-3) \end{aligned}$$

\]
